Output ffb21afa87f4506e3bc5eb391d82fc4fa5558056d0cfe64b72ea3da35e84fd0a:1

value
11826900
script pubkey
OP_0 OP_PUSHBYTES_20 5cd37a55c9bc56eb3bdb02d6ce2f7ba99dca8caf
address
bc1qtnfh54wfh3twkw7mqttvutmm4xwu4r90zekktz
transaction
ffb21afa87f4506e3bc5eb391d82fc4fa5558056d0cfe64b72ea3da35e84fd0a
spent
true